PVBL: Deadwood Outlaws
Shutout in Moyer's First Start

May 20, 1999

--LHP Jamie Moyer (3-0) made his first start of the season, pitching 7 scoreless innings in Deadwood's 3-0 win over Truro today. 3B Travis Fryman knocked in two first inning runs, while SS Chris Gomez homered to provide all the scoring neccessary against former Outlaw RHP Bartolo Colon (1-2).

Tomorrow is a travel day for the McCoy Division leading Outlaws, with their next game being Friday May 21st back home in Deadwood. Newly re-aquired 1B Tino Martinez and brand new 3B Scott Brosius are expected to be available in time to play.
